Elchin Behbudov told APA that 25 persons are detained in the facility: “Most of them were arrested over reckless driving. I met there with three APFP members. One of them Ulvi Nuriyev is studying master’s degree at Bridgestone University, UK. He has been detained for 25 days. Another one was Joshgun Salahov. He is jobless and has been detained for 30 days. Third person that I met was Ali Karimli’s son Turkel Karimli. He has been detained for 25 days. He is the third year student of Bridgestone University. I met with them in the cell where they are detained. The have not complained about the detention conditions or attitude towards them. However, they are dissatisfied with the decision of the court. According to media reports, they are treated badly and are not permitted to meet with the family members. These are groundless. I talked to the chief of detention facility. He said that according to the rules, meeting with the family members is permitted on Monday-Friday at 15:00-17:00. So, anyone can meet during the determined time. There is no problem”.
